Silvery Gold Blossoms, Moody 19th Century Theorem Watercolor small brush and a ton of usefulA bit of an unusual theorem style watercolor in terms of the color of the blooms and blue spatter painting in and among them, which I really love, giving the suggestion of shadowy density. The effect is to impart the bunch with a certain moodiness, with a bit of a momento mori feel. And the color reads as a combination of silver and gold. 9" x 5 3 4". Watercolor on paper, c. mid 19th century. With the initials GR glued to the reverse. Good condition,
